Seeking opinions from anyone who’s been to both or knows if ML is any good. I realize they are completely different parks overall with DS being a full service all inclusive type of experience, but we’d be specifically going for the dolphin interaction. We‘ll be traveling down from MI in mid July, so I’m on the fence about DC due to the chance of rain ruining the day. I’ve been to FL enough in the summer to know that this could be a real issue with all of the DC activities being dependent on decent weather. And considering the cost, this makes me nervous. I’m looking into ML simply because it’s less of a commitment and obviously cheaper. My daughter’s dream has always been to touch/swim with dolphins and we’ve never done it, so I’m looking for a good way to accomplish this. Are there any other similar options?
 
First off Marineland is two hours away from WDW. So you'll need a car. Discovery Cove obviously wins hands down as an overall experience. My kids still cant stop talking about it. BUT if all you are after is the dolphin encounter, and you have a rental car, the Marineland will certainly fit the bill. At Marineland you can see the actual ocean, although you are floating in a big tank with life jackets on. At Discovery Cove you stand waist deep in a huge manmade lagoon for the interaction.
